SMART2 Progress - Federal Street

  • 4 September 2024
  • cyoh

Save some minor landscaping work and sidewalk detailing around Ohio Edison utility access panels, construction on West Federal Street is now finished.

An unloading pull-out for Oh Wow, along Market Street, on the southwest corner of the Central Square, remains to be constructed.

Construction on East Federal Street, between Central Square and Champion Street, is still on hold, due to the ongoing demolition of the damaged Realty Building. Sidewalk, curbing, and pavement remediation work will be needed, due to damage from the gas explosion.

Closing of Industrial Rd.

  • 12 August 2024
  • cyoh

Complete reconstruction of Industrial Road, between South Meridian Road and Bears Den Road, will begin on August 12, 2024. Industrial Road, between Bears Den Road and South Meridian Road, will be closed, open to local traffic only, effective Monday, August 12, 2024, for approximately four (4) months.

Detour signs will be posted accordingly.

SMART2 Progress - Commerce Street

  • 21 May 2024
  • cyoh

Now that major demolition work at 20 Federal Place has finished, construction has resumed on West Commerce Street, between the Phelps Street Gateway and Wick Avenue. Work is progressing on the south side of the street, which had been inaccesible during the building demolition work.

With the exception of the Phelps Street Gateway to Wick Avenue block, all of Commerce Street is open to traffic.

Update to MAH-Boardman Walnut PID 116833 - News Release

  • 11 January 2024
  • public works

Update: January 11, 2024
In addition to the project details from the January 4, 2024 News Release, the city of Youngstown also proposes to reconstruct the closed roadway section of Walnut Street between Commerce Street and Wood Street with a Step Street. A Step Street is a thoroughfare fitted with steps for pedestrian traffic rather than paved for motor vehicular traffic. This Step Street will be designed during construction and it is included in the attached plan for location purposes only.
